Transaction fc3a6121079ede325f0711fc6afd4f0e8a54bba20faec7e0168a3bfb729f65da
1 Input
1 Output
-
fc3a6121079ede325f0711fc6afd4f0e8a54bba20faec7e0168a3bfb729f65da:0
- value
- 3730707
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 07acc25e0bab547d3d54a60795b1e569069eb1ba OP_EQUAL
- address
- 32PbcQht1cXZ1mdZmgqyT4AqhBYzvEdvFn